Underbrush Clearing in Houston, TX

Underbrush clearing services involve the removal of dense, unwanted vegetation such as shrubs, small trees, and thick undergrowth that can overrun a property. This type of work is often requested for projects like preparing land for new landscaping, creating clear pathways, or maintaining safety around residential yards. Property owners typically want to understand the scope of the clearing, including what types of plants will be removed, the extent of the area covered, and any potential impact on existing trees or structures.

Before requesting underbrush clearing, homeowners should consider the size of the area needing work, the types of vegetation present, and any local regulations or restrictions related to land clearing. It’s also helpful to clarify whether the project involves complete removal or selective thinning, and to discuss any concerns about debris disposal or future land use. Proper planning ensures the clearing aligns with property goals and results in a tidy, accessible outdoor space.

Project Types

Common Underbrush Clearing Jobs

Brush Removal - clearing overgrown vegetation to improve yard appearance and safety.

Thicket Clearing - removing dense underbrush to create open spaces for landscaping or recreation.

Pathway Clearing - maintaining clear access routes through wooded or brushy areas.

Fence Line Clearing - trimming back undergrowth along property boundaries to prevent damage and define borders.

Firebreak Clearing - creating defensible space by removing combustible underbrush around structures.

Lot Clearing - preparing land for development by removing brush, shrubs, and small trees.

FAQ

Underbrush Clearing Questions

What is underbrush clearing? Underbrush clearing involves removing small trees, shrubs, and dense vegetation to improve the safety and appearance of a property.

Why should property owners consider underbrush clearing? Clearing underbrush reduces fire risk, improves visibility, and creates more usable outdoor space.

What types of projects typically require underbrush clearing? Projects may include preparing land for construction, maintaining firebreaks, or creating clear pathways and lawns.

How often should underbrush clearing be performed? Regular clearing is recommended to prevent overgrowth and maintain a tidy, safe landscape.
